There are three basic body types. Keep in mind that it is possible to be a mix of each type.
Ectomorph: This body type is tall and slim with long arms and legs. With this body type you may have difficulty gaining weight and building muscle. Ballet dancers, models, and long-distance runners tend to have the ectomorph body type.
Mesomorph: This body type is shorter and muscular and has stocky arms and legs. With this body type you are strong and gain muscle mass when you do strength training. You may have difficulty losing weight. Mesomorph body types usually excel at power sports, such as soccer, softball, and sprinting events in track and field.
Endomorph: This body type carries more body fat. The endomorph body type can be apple shaped or pear shaped. Endomorph body types excel at distance swimming, field events, and weightlifting.
